Jing Hu is an Assistant Professor in the Department of Civil, Environmental and Construction Engineering at the University of Central Florida, College of Engineering. She leads the Nature-Based Solutions Lab and focuses on biogeochemical processes in managed ecosystems.
Her research interests include:
- Biogeochemistry in soil-water systems
- Greenhouse gas emission mitigation
- Nature-based solutions for water quality
- Carbon sequestration and storage
- Treatment wetlands and ecological engineering
- Nutrient and contaminant dynamics in soil-plant-water systems

Notable scientific awards include:
- Excellent Young Scientist Award, Association of Chinese Soil and Plant Scientists in North America (2022)
- Featured Cover Article in Nature Climate Change (2021)
- Wiley Top Cited Article in Soil Use and Management (2020–2021)

Her editorial roles include serving as an associate editor for Agronomy Journal: Soil and Water Management and as a founding member of the young editorial board for Soil and Environmental Health Journal.
